A night of excellence

It was a night of pride for print media journalists in the country when the best in the field were feted at the annual Journalism Awards for Excellence, organized jointly by The Editors’ Guild of Sri Lanka (TEGOSL) and the Sri Lanka Press Institute (SLPI). The awards night, a much looked forward to event of the journalistic fraternity was held last Tuesday at the Mount Lavinia Hotel.

The top award of the night, the Mervyn de Silva Journalist of the Year was won by Gayan Kumara Weerasinghe Karunaratne of the Lakbima daily, weekly and Lakbima News newspapers. President of the World Association of Newspapers and News Publishers (WAN-IFRA) Jacob Mathew who was chief guest on the occasion gave away this prestigious and coveted award.

The Sepala Gunasena Award for Defending Press Freedom in Sri Lanka went to the Editor of the Lanka newspaper Chandana Sirimalwatte. The Sunday Times bagged five awards including the Best Designed Newspaper of the Year, Scoop of the Year -The Sunday Times News Desk, Upali Wijewardene Feature Writer of the Year -Chandani Kirinde, Environmental Reporter of the Year -Malaka Rodrigo and Photojournalist of the Year- Merit award- Gemunu Wellage.

Four veteran journalists were also honoured with Life Time Achievement Awards. They were Lloyd Rajaratnam Devarajah , Sarath Cooray, S. M. Gopalaratnam and Bandula Harischandra.
This year was the 12th edition of the industry driven awards programme, which was first begun by The Editors’ Guild in 1998. The programme aims at recognizing and rewarding excellence in the field of journalism.

Awards were given in several other categories including Investigative Journalist of the Year, Subramaniyam Chettiar Award for Reporting on Social Issues , Sports Journalist of the Year ,Denzil Peiris Young Reporter of the Year (Under 26 years), Business Journalist of the Year (Three Awards: Sinhala, Tamil and English) , Cartoonist of the Year , B. A. Siriwardena Columnist of the Year (Three Awards: Sinhala, Tamil and English) and the Prof. K. Kailasapathy Award for Reporting under Special Circumstances The D.R. Wijewardene Award for Earning the Recognition of Peers and the Public was not awarded this year.
